What Is Irving City Jail?
First things first, what exactly is Irving City Jail? Simply put, it’s a detention facility located in Irving, Texas, where individuals who’ve been arrested are held until their cases are resolved. But it’s more than just a building with bars. It’s a hub of activity where legal proceedings, administrative processes, and human experiences all come together.
According to official records, Irving City Jail serves as a short-term holding facility for individuals awaiting trial or transfer to other institutions. It’s part of the larger criminal justice system, and its role is crucial in maintaining public safety while ensuring due process.

How Does Someone End Up in Irving City Jail?
Arrest and Booking Process
Let’s talk about the journey from arrest to detention. When someone is arrested, they go through a booking process where their information is recorded, and they’re fingerprinted and photographed. After that, they’re taken to Irving City Jail, where they’ll stay until their case is resolved.
What Happens Next?
Once inside, detainees go through an intake process. This includes a health screening and an assessment of their needs. From there, they’re assigned to a cell and given a set of rules to follow. It’s not glamorous, but it’s necessary to maintain order and safety within the facility.
